Where We First Saw It: It is Guardians of the Galaxy's Star-Lord who first introduces us to the Power Stone, successfully finding it contained within an Orb on the deserted planet Morag. More than just creating space portals or controlling individual minds, this thing has the inherent ability, under the right circumstances, to flick off the universe like a light switch and effectively change reality. What It Does: Though the rules surrounding the Reality Stone are perhaps the most unclear of the revealed Infinity Stones thus far, one thing is pretty damn clear: the sucker is powerful. As to prevent two Infinity Stones from being kept in the same place, the Asgardians decided to trust it to The Collector (though he doesn't actually seem all that trustworthy). Where We Last Saw It: Unfortunately, the Aether was discovered again, and after Malekith once again tried to execute his plan, Thor was able to get the red liquid ingot back into protective hands. This plan, as seen in the opening of Thor: The Dark World, was stopped by the Asgardians, and the Aether was hidden between worlds in the hopes of never being discovered again. Where We First Saw It: A millennia ago, the Dark Elf leader known as Malekith tried to use the Reality Stone - also known as the Aether - to try and return the universe to a state of eternal darkness. Basically, if you need a mind created, manipulated, or changed, the Mind Stone is what you need. As though, that weren't enough, Tony Stark then uses it in The Avengers: Age of Ultron to form the first ever artificial intelligence, and then his creation, Ultron, uses it to create Vision. Then, in the Captain America: The Winter Soldier mid-credits scene, it was revealed that the stone was actually somehow used to bring out innate powers within Wanda and Pietro Maximoff, turning them into Scarlet Witch and Quicksilver, respectively. ![]() At first, Loki uses it to hypnotize individuals - including Hawkeye - to try and steal the Tesseract. What It Does: Since it was first introduced, the Mind Stone has actually proven to be useful in many ways, both good and bad. Where We Last Saw It: As seen in The Avengers: Age of Ultron and Captain America: Civil War, this pretty yellow ingot is now safely nestled in the forehead of Vision - who is extremely well equipped to take care of it. It was positioned within the gem of the God of Mischief's staff. Where We First Saw It: While we didn't know it was the Mind Stone at the time, this one first showed up in The Avengers when Thanos gave it to Loki so that he could lead the Chitauri's invasion of Earth. Stropping, however, is relatively easy, and will keep an already sharpened edge in perfect nick indefinitely, whether you use polymer or PMC.īriefly, stropping consists of pressing/cutting a mirror image of the gouge angle into a soft wood (like bass), applying a compound, and running the gouge lightly down the groove. To duplicate the original angle of the gouge is extremely difficult. A special jig is used to sharpen the gouge when its originally made. Its not practical to think in terms of sharpening gouges because its too difficult to maintain the angle of the gouge edge against a stone. Metal clay on the other hand, because it contains metal, will dull your gouges over time. If used exclusively for polymer, gouges won’t dull much with use. Clear plastic tube can be purchased at a hardware store and cut to slip over the gouge tip. Always protect the gouge tip from knocking around in your work-bag. If your gouge is sharp when you buy it, here are a few tips for maintaining the edge. You need to first acquire resources to make the upgrade, and then by applying crafting notes to the recipe you can improve their overall quality. Iron Ingots, Silver Ingots, Copper IngotsĬrafting upgrades work similar to crafting ships. To the right you can also see the Naval Action Crafting tree, the blue ones are default and the red ones are non default ones, so those you need to acquire the blue print for. Crafting level is improved through the experience attained while crafting parts, modules, and ships. Ships also require certain crafting levels and the more Crafting Notes that are put into a ship, the higher the crafting level is needed to complete that ship. The resulting handling of ship also depends on whether the wood used is fir, teak, oak, or live oak (live oak being the slowest but strongest, with fir the fastest but weakest). The quality of the built-in upgrades of ships depends on how many crafting notes you include in the recipe. Crafting Notes are also dropped randomly when breaking up a ship for parts. These ingots are then crafted into gold coins, which are used with coal to craft (or buy) Crafting Notes. Ships recipes randomly drop either when crafting ships, or when breaking up a ship (which can also give crafting resources).Ĭrafting Notes are typically made from acquiring gold and combining it with coal to create gold ingots. Resources can be difficult to attain for each ships recipe, and can be time consuming to retain. Certain ships construction need unique components, with differing amounts of resources needed in each ships crafting recipe. Crafting in the current stage of Naval Actions involves gathering resources to construct ships. And, in doing so, urges the open-ended question of how we care for ourselves and each other in our broader social worlds. This conversation between over 50 works of art across media considers and reveals the multi-faceted nature of the ways care is conveyed and experienced. The artworks on view range from portrayals of familial relations and societal obligations, to gestures of hospitality and ritual, from strategies of bearing witness and evoking empathy, to explorations of networks of care and the results of their absences. Whether an accumulation of small gestures, a singular bold act, or even strategic indifference, expressions of care-or the lack thereof-shape the world in which we live, a world that is often fraught with competing tensions and complexities.ĭrawing generously from the Smart Museum’s collection, Take Care seeks to unpack matters of care from the personal to the collective. It can be driven by moral imperative or necessity. What does it mean to care for something, someone, or ourselves?Ĭaring can be a form of affection, a survival strategy, a political tool, a mode of labor, and a means of sustenance. ![]() Microsoft SQL Server 2005 (9.
